About Admiralty & Maritime Law in Varanasi, India
Varanasi, due to its location along the Ganges River, has its own unique maritime considerations. While traditionally known for its spiritual significance, Varanasi also plays a role in riverine commerce and transport. Admiralty and maritime law in this region encompasses issues related to shipping, navigation, and marine commerce. Despite Varanasi not being a coastal city, the Ganges River holds significant commercial value, making an understanding of maritime law essential.

Local Laws Overview
Maritime law in India is primarily governed by statutes such as the Admiralty (Jurisdiction and Settlement of Maritime Claims) Act, 2017, which outlines the jurisdiction of High Courts in maritime matters. Although Varanasi falls under the jurisdiction of the Allahabad High Court, local regulations specific to river transportation and commerce on the Ganges River may also apply. These regulations deal with navigational safety, environmental protections, and the management of riverine resources.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What is admiralty and maritime law?
Admiralty and maritime law governs legal issues related to marine commerce, navigation, shipping, and the transportation of goods and passengers over water.
2. Do I need a maritime lawyer if my business operates on the Ganges?
If your business involves river transportation, shipping, or fisheries, consulting a maritime lawyer can ensure compliance with applicable laws and help navigate any legal disputes.
3. How do maritime laws apply to Varanasi?
While Varanasi isn't a coastal city, laws pertaining to inland waterways and river transport are relevant due to its location along the Ganges River.
4. Are there specific regulations for cargo transport on the Ganges?
Yes, there are regulations that address the safety and environmental impact of cargo transport on the Ganges, which businesses must adhere to.
5. What legal recourse is available for injuries sustained on a vessel?
Individuals injured on a vessel may be entitled to compensation through maritime injury claims, and should consult a lawyer specializing in these claims.
6. What is the role of the Allahabad High Court in maritime matters?
The Allahabad High Court handles the adjudication of maritime claims arising from the Ganges River within its jurisdiction, including Varanasi.
7. Can a maritime lawyer assist with environmental compliance?
A maritime lawyer can guide you through complying with environmental laws related to pollution control and sustainable practices on inland waterways.
8. How are maritime contracts enforced in Varanasi?
Maritime contracts are enforced through the legal framework set by the Admiralty Act and relevant local regulations, often requiring legal adjudication.
9. What happens in the event of a shipping dispute?
A shipping dispute can involve contract breaches or cargo claims, and may require mediation or litigation under the guidance of a maritime lawyer.
10. Can individuals sue for environmental damage caused by ships?
Yes, individuals or groups can file claims for environmental damage under applicable laws, seeking redress for pollution or ecological harm by maritime activities.
